Delaware Sand & Gravel Landfill
Superfund site in New Castle, DE · EPA ID DED000605972
Delaware Sand & Gravel Landfill is a Superfund site in New Castle, DE on the EPA National Priorities List (Currently on the Final NPL). Contaminants of concern include 1,2,4-TRIMETHYLBENZENE, 1,3,5-TRIMETHYLBENZENE, 1,4-DIOXANE, 2-BUTANONE (METHYL ETHYL KETONE). At Delaware Sand & Gravel Landfill, the EPA has determined that human exposure is under control.
